Which is a similarity between the first quarter moon and the third quarter moon

One similarity between the first quarter moon and the third quarter moon is that they both appear half illuminated from the perspective of an observer on Earth. This means that the sun's light is shining on one half of the moon's surface, while the other half remains in shadow.
